Bonjour ladies and gentlemen.

France's Hunting season has started a month ago but due to work and social obligations I wasn't able to partake in our first 3 driven hunts. By all accounts the first 3 were amazing. In the first one 12 boars were shot in less than an hour. Second and third delivered 8 and 7 boars each.

Saturday morning we were hunting an area called Le Cacalau, Provençal for snail. I were posted on the edge of an olive grove. Very dense in front of me but a lane of about 6 m between last olive tree and a excuse for a fence. When we got to our posts I were posted at the bottom of the small hill but I asked the organizers if I can deplace my post with 20m to be able to see both sides.



Things started very slow. We were on our posts for more than an hour before anything were chased up. I saw a boar at around 400m but obviously didn't shoot. It went to the other side and my friend shot at 3 times killing it. A while later I saw another boar of around 60kg at almost the same spot but it was coming down on our side. I had the cross on it, and when it stopped I was ready to shoot at around 230m. It is far in France but not where we hunt. I had the rifle on the tripod and as I were calculating my shot the guy next to me decided to hurry the pig up and started shooting at 300m.

I had the scope dialed up to 6 for the longer shot.


The boar was supposed to come our way and I were frantically looking for it, next moment I heard a noise to my left and a group off younger pigs of around 30kgs each ran out of the olive grove. I shouldered the 308 and the first one dropped just after the first olive tree. Let the second one pass as I reloaded and shot the 3rd one just as it got to the fence. Reloaded and gave a hurried shot at 5th one. Wounded it. The rest all disappeared into the impenetrable bush behind me.


À while later the dogs came by and chased up the one I wounded and I eventually killed it with a knife. I've never even shot a double and now a triple in my first hunt of the year. To say I'm stoked is a understatement! Last year I only shot 2 in 27 hunts and today 3. Thanks to all the trackers and dogs!
